高效网站程序上传工具 一键快速部署
网站程序上传工具:提升开发效率的必备利器

在网站开发与运维过程中,程序上传工具是连接本地与服务器的重要桥梁。无论是个人站长还是企业技术团队,高效、稳定的上传工具能显著缩短项目部署时间,降低操作风险。本文将围绕网站程序上传工具的核心功能、主流选择及使用技巧展开,帮助开发者快速找到适合的解决方案。
一、网站程序上传工具的核心功能
一款优秀的网站程序上传工具应具备以下特性:支持多种传输协议(如FTP、SFTP、WebDAV),确保兼容不同服务器环境;提供断点续传和批量上传功能,避免因网络波动导致重复操作;文件同步和权限管理能力也至关重要,可减少人为配置错误。例如,FileZilla、WinSCP等工具因其稳定性和开源特性,成为许多开发者的首选。
二、主流上传工具横向对比
目前市场上常见的工具可分为三类:免费开源型(如FileZilla)、付费专业型(如Transmit)和集成化平台(如宝塔面板)。免费工具适合预算有限的个人用户,但功能可能受限;付费工具通常提供更快的传输速度和高级加密;而集成化平台则适合需要一站式管理的用户,例如通过宝塔面板直接上传并解压压缩包。开发者需根据项目规模和安全需求灵活选择。
三、使用技巧与避坑指南
上传网站程序时,需注意三个关键点:一是压缩文件后再上传,可大幅减少传输时间;二是避免直接覆盖生产环境文件,建议先备份再操作;三是检查服务器权限设置,防止因权限不足导致上传失败。推荐使用SFTP协议而非传统FTP,以提升数据传输的安全性。对于大型文件,可借助命令行工具(如rsync)实现高效同步。
四、未来趋势与行业建议
随着云服务和DevOps的普及,网站程序上传工具正朝着自动化、智能化方向发展。例如,结合CI/CD流水线实现一键部署,或通过AI检测上传文件的潜在风险。建议开发者关注工具与云服务的整合能力,同时定期更新软件版本,防范已知漏洞。
总结
网站程序上传工具虽是小众领域,却是开发流程中不可或缺的一环。选择适合的工具并掌握高效使用方法,能显著提升工作效率。无论是新手还是资深运维人员,都应重视工具的稳定性与安全性,从而为网站项目的顺利运行打下坚实基础。





